Artist: Camille Tharaud ( 1878-1956) Limoges - Céramiste Français
Very elegant enameled porcelain vase with polychrome floral decoration. Signed under the base. Camille Tharaud is a French ceramist, known for his decorated porcelain works, with frank and deep tones, soft to the touch, formed from molten colored enamel, made from granite pebbles from Limousin. His works are present in various Museums including the National Museum of Limoges Adrien Dubouché.
